iZombie Season 5 Episode 8 Death of a Car Salesman Closes the Deal [SPOILER REVIEW]

"iZombie" Season 5, Episode 8 "Death of a Car Salesman" Closes the Deal [SPOILER REVIEW]

Will Liv go head to head with her father? What will happen to the zombies in Washington? Will Liv and Major get back together? For sure, Blaine will survive whatever comes his way, and I predict will walk away having consumed one of the Freylick brains. iZombie season 5, episode 9 "The Fresh Princess": LIV EATS[...]